We plan to finish our Camino by bussing to Finisterre or Muxia (we plan to go to both) and overnighting and then back to Santiago. There is no time to walk after being gone several weeks. Just wondering...are there more bus times/availability from Finisterre or Muxia? I thought as soon as we arrive we'd buy an advance ticket for departure.

Also, do most people go to Muxia first and then bus out of Finisterre or reverse and are there any advantages for either?

We were going to spend one night in each town.

Finally, I cannot find Finisterre on Google maps. I only see Fisterra. Are they one and the same? Thank you!
 
New Original Camino Gear Designed Especially with The Modern Peregrino In Mind!
Finally, I cannot find Finisterre on Google maps. I only see Fisterra. Are they one and the same?
Yes, Fisterra is the local (Galician) name.

There are more daily buses from Fisterra than Muxía.

You can find schedules for both on the Monbus site
